You probably won’t hear about it on the news, but hundreds of thousands of pro-life warriors will travel to Washington, D.C. on January 18th for the March for Life. People of all ages and backgrounds will unite to stand for life and promote the 2019 theme, “Unique From Day One”.

If you’re not able to travel to take part in this march, pray the 9 Days for Life Novena that begins on January 14th.
